c 操作技巧

2021-09-08 16:37:22 字數 767 閱讀 4884

一直以來很多細節都沒有記錄,現在要注意了好記性不如爛筆頭,***

1、(winform)中c# 怎樣判斷 datagridview  中的checkbox列是否被選中

for (int i = 0; i < datagridview1.rows.count; i++)

}2、datagridview  中的checkbox列全選操作 

private void checkall_checkedchanged(object sender, eventargs e)

} }

3、datagridview  中的checkbox列反選

private void checkreverse_checkedchanged(object sender, eventargs e)

else

} }

}4、c#保留小數點後2位

double dbdata = 0.55555;

string str1 = dbdata.tostring("f2");//fn 保留n位,四捨五入

string str1 = string.format("", 5.6789); //result: 56,789.0

5、c#顯示角度符號

string str1 = string.format("", 5.6789); //result: 56,789.0

textbox1.text = str1+"°";

特殊符號--開啟搜狗--選單--軟鍵盤---特殊符號 選擇"°"搞定。

c 操作技巧

一直以來很多細節都沒有記錄,現在要注意了好記性不如爛筆頭,1 winform 中c 怎樣判斷 datagridview 中的checkbox列是否被選中 for int i 0 i datagridview1.rows.count i 2 datagridview 中的checkbox列全選操作 p...

C 位操作技巧

一 注意事項 a 與 兩位都為1,才為1 b 或 兩位都為0,才為0 c 微操作只能用於整形資料,float和double進行位操作時編譯器會報錯 d 異或 兩位相同為0,不同為1 e 取反 1變為0,0變為1 f 左移 各二進位制全部向左移位,高位丟失,低位補零 g 右移 各二進位制全部向右移位,...

C 位操作技巧

一 注意事項 a 與 兩位都為1,才為1 b 或 兩位都為0,才為0 c 微操作只能用於整形資料,float和double進行位操作時編譯器會報錯 d 異或 兩位相同為0,不同為1 e 取反 1變為0,0變為1 f 左移 g 右移 各二進位制全部向右移位,對於無符號數,低位丟失,高位補零 有符號數個...